Palmer Luckey was born in 1992 in Long Beach, California. He was homeschooled by his mother but began taking college courses when he was in his mid-teens. As a teenager, Luckey demonstrated a serious interest in electronics and earned money repairing iPhones; he used the money to purchase virtual reality headsets, amassing a collection of more than 50. At the age of 17 in his parents’ garage, Luckey created his first prototype for what would become the Oculus Rift. Luckey launched his company, Oculus VR, in June 2012 and began fundraising for the production of the Oculus Rift with a Kickstarter campaign in August, 2012. Oculus VR’s Kickstarter campaign had an initial goal of $250,000; it raised $2,437,429. Facebook acquired Oculus VR in 2014, after which Luckey worked for Facebook until his departure from the company in 2017.
